Amount and payment of training bursaries7

1

Subject to sub-paragraph (2), a training bursary shall be £1,300 per annum in respect of a full-time course and in the case of a part-time course it shall be such proportion of that amount in each year as the number of hours of instruction in that year bears to 700.

2

A student attending a course of the kind mentioned in regulation 5(c)(v) shall, in addition to the sums payable under sub-paragraph (1), be paid once only an equipment allowance of £200.

3

A training bursary (including any equipment allowance) may be paid in a lump sum or by instalments in either case at such times as the Secretary of State considers appropriate.

4

For the purpose of this regulation a full-time course means a course involving 700 hours or more of instruction per year (including any teaching practice which forms part of the course) and a part-time course means a course involving less than 700 hours of such instruction.
